Introduction:In today’s digital era, Open Source Software (OSS) stands as a beacon of collaboration, innovation, and empowerment. From operating systems to web development frameworks, OSS has revolutionized the way we interact with technology. This article delves into the nuances of Open Source Software, exploring its history, impact, and future prospects.
Unveiling the Essence of Open Source Software
Open Source Software embodies the ethos of transparency and inclusivity. Unlike proprietary software, which is controlled by single entities, OSS encourages community-driven development and distribution. This fosters a culture of creativity and accessibility, empowering users to modify, distribute, and enhance software freely.
The Genesis of Open Source Software
At the heart of OSS lies a rich history rooted in collaboration and shared values. The concept traces its origins to the Free Software Movement spearheaded by visionaries like Richard Stallman. Their advocacy for software freedom laid the groundwork for the emergence of OSS as a viable alternative to closed-source solutions.
The Pillars of Open Source Software
1. Licensing Freedom:
Open Source Software thrives on the principles of open licensing, which grants users the freedom to use.
2. Community Collaboration:
Central to OSS is the vibrant community of developers, enthusiasts, and users who contribute to projects, share knowledge, and provide support.
3. Transparency and Accountability:
Unlike proprietary software, OSS offers transparency into its source code, allowing users to inspect, audit, and improve software.
Open Source Software in Action
From web browsers to content management systems, Open Source Software powers a myriad of applications across diverse domains. Here are some notable examples:
Linux Operating System: Serving as the backbone of countless servers and devices worldwide, Linux exemplifies the reliability of OSS.
Apache Web Server: As the most widely used web server software, Apache exemplifies the robustness and versatility of OSS in web hosting environments.
WordPress CMS: Empowering millions of websites, blogs, and online stores, WordPress showcases the flexibility and extensibility of OSS in content management.
Embracing the Future of Open Source Softwares
As technology continues to evolve, the relevance and impact of Open Source Softwares are poised to grow exponentially. Emerging trends such as containerization, microservices architecture, and blockchain technology underscore the enduring relevance of OSS in shaping the digital landscape.
FAQs
What is Open Source Softwares? Open Source Softwares refers to softwares whose source code is freely available for users to view, modify, and distribute according to the terms of its respective license.
How is Open Source Softwares different from proprietary softwares? Unlike proprietary software, which is controlled by single entities and restricts user access to its source code, Open Source Softwares encourages collaboration, transparency, and community-driven development.
Is Open Source Softwares secure? While no softwares is immune to vulnerabilities, the collaborative nature of Open Source Softwares often leads to rapid identification and mitigation of security issues, making it inherently more secure in many cases.
Can I make money from Open Source Softwares? Yes, many individuals and organizations generate revenue through services, support, and customization of Open Source Softwares. Additionally, some OSS projects offer commercial licenses or supplementary products for monetization.
What are some popular Open Source Softwares licenses? Common Open Source Softwares licenses include the GNU General Public License (GPL), MIT License, Apache License, and BSD License, each with its own set of permissions and requirements.
Conclusion:
In conclusion, Open Source Softwares transcends mere code; it embodies a philosophy of openness, collaboration, and empowerment. As we navigate the complexities of the digital age, embracing the principles of OSS paves the way for a more inclusive, transparent, and innovative future.